Social media has become ingrained in our lives. We know excessive consumption of social media is harmful to us yet we cannot stop scrolling. So why not use them for our own growth?

Here’s how I’m transforming my Instagram, Pinterest, and YouTube feeds into spaces of inspiration and self-improvement.

The Power of Social Media Algorithms:

Social media platforms employ sophisticated algorithms to sort content to users. It tracks each and every single interaction you do on the platform. The kind of posts you like, save, share etc. It then curates your feed based on the metrics it collects. It keeps suggesting you similar content on your feed, keeping you hooked to the platform.

Excessive consumption of such content will waste our precious time and leaves us no time for focusing on our goals.

Using social media for self-growth:

Unfollowing: The First Step Toward Growth:

If you’re constantly bombarded with content that doesn’t bring any real value ( content like gossip, self-deprecating jokes etc), then you’ll not cultivate growth mindset. Just as we learn from people around us in real lives, the same applies with virtual world. Only when you follow content that aligns with your goals, will you strive to do better.

The first and the foremost thing to do is to unfollow people or pages that don’t make you feel good or inspire you to do better.

Curating feed intentionally :

The second thing to do is to reflect to understand what kind of content you want to consume. It can be anything like books, music, art, finance, coding, astronomy, fashion etc.

Once you figure out your interests, look for influencers or pages that produce quality content in those spaces and follow them.

For example, I’m trying to develop a reading habit. I’ve started following influencers who discuss books, give recommendations and share reading experiences. Now, every time I open instagram, my feed is filled with books related content. This way, I’ve started discovering popular books and authors. It is inspiring me to read more. I’ve already finished 5 books so far this year and I’m onto my 6th one already!

If you’re looking to learn more about personal finance, start following people or pages that produce quality content on personal finance.

Whatever your goal is, try intentionally curating feed that aligns with your goal.

Be intentional of what you consume and don’t let the algorithm dictate it.

Pinterest for Personal Growth: Building a Vision Board

In my opinion, pinterest is the best of all social media platforms. It doesn’t have any nonsense as other platforms.

On pinterest, you can create boards for different things like fashion, books, music, movies etc. It will curate feed based on the the boards you’ve created.

Pinterest is also great for manifestation and visualization. Create a vision board and save pins related to that. Every time you open it, it suggests pins that align with your vision and you’ll feel motivated to do better, to achieve better.

Final Thoughts:

Ensure your social media reflects your goals and interests. Curating your feed intentionally can transform your scrolling experience from a time-waster into a tool for self-growth.
